Me, my sister Kirsty and my brother in law Sean, we all took a day visit to the City of Dublin on the Emerald Island, Ireland.

The city is so beautiful and well looked after. The only thing that let it down for us was the poorly organised public transport system for those who are tourists. The post offices there aren't informed very well for informing tourists on how to pay for transport, this is where it was really disorganised both in the post offices and the train stations provided. By the time we made it to the city, after purchasing a very expensive train ticket from a ticket booth, we hoofed it from one side of the city to the other until we reached our intended destination - the infamous world-renown Guinness Storehouse on St. James' Gate. The warehouses were huge!

I'll happily go back to Dublin but I would advise booking transportation or looking up how to navigate the transportation system in Republic of Ireland as this was the most frustrating part of the entire micro-holiday.

Quote by Dewi Sant (Saint David)

“Gwnewch y pethau bychain mewn bywyd” is a common Welsh phrase, in English it means “Do the little things”.
It comes from the last words spoken by St. David, the patron Saint of Wales, whose feast day is the 1st March.
The whole sentence he was supposed to have said is “Be joyful, keep the faith and do the little things that you have heard and seen me do”.
In the literal sense, it means if you keep doing things by putting one foot in front of the other, they will eventually make up to bigger and better things in the long run.

Welsh Phrase
“Byddwch lawen a chadwch eich ffydd a'ch cred, a gwnewch y pethau bychain a welsoch ac a glywsoch gennyf i.”


English Translation

“Be joyful, keep your faith and your creed, and do the little things that you have seen me do and heard about.”
